@keyframes back-to-top-module__w0ix6G__appear{0%{opacity:0;pointer-events:none;transform:translateY(8px)}to{opacity:1;pointer-events:auto;transform:none}}.back-to-top-module__w0ix6G__root{z-index:50;bottom:var(--mantine-spacing-xl);right:var(--mantine-spacing-xl);border:2px solid var(--mantine-color-dark-8);color:var(--mantine-color-dark-8);transition:box-shadow .15s,translate .15s;animation:linear both back-to-top-module__w0ix6G__appear;animation-timeline:scroll();animation-range:350px 400px;position:fixed}.back-to-top-module__w0ix6G__root:hover{box-shadow:4px 4px 0 var(--mantine-color-primary-8);translate:-2px -2px}
